    Rock the Ocean's Tortuga Music Festival is an annual music festival held at Fort Lauderdale Beach Park in Fort Lauderdale, Florida. The festival is usually scheduled for early April in Fort Lauderdale. Founded by A.J. Niland and Chris Stacey, the annual spring festival aimed to raise awareness and support for ocean conservation.

    The Elbo Room is a bar that was established in 1938 at 241 South Fort Lauderdale Beach Boulevard, Fort Lauderdale, Florida and that became a landmark for Fort Lauderdale Beach.
